Andy,

As I read your post it sounds like your receivers may have the old G connector, if so, those Rx are almost certainly not narrow band. The Tx, depending on age may be narrow band, check for the gold sticker. You can't fly an old wide band AM or FM system at an AMA club field, if you fly by yourself in the boonies I guess you could use them.
As to FM being better, in theory for sure, but most guys who have had both couldn't tell the difference, especially when you fly like I do
